Cereal crop production of Jordan in 2023 amounted to 72 666 tonnes, which is 10.45% more than in 2022, when it was  65 793 tonnes. This is the first year of growth after a decline. According to the FAOSTAT data, since 1961, the volume of annual ceral production has decreased in 2.86 times. The minimum production of grains was recorded in 1999, with a value of 14 460 tonnes. The maximum of Jordan was in 1964, when it reached 400 558 metric tons. Area and production data on cereals relate to crops harvested for dry grain only. Cereal crops harvested for hay or harvested green for food, feed or silage or used for grazing are therefore excluded.
Additional infomation: About indicator
Includes wheat, barley, rye, maize (corn), rice, buckwheat, oats, millet, canary seed, fonio, quinoa, sorghum, triticale, mixed grain. Production data on cereals relate to crops harvested for dry grain only. Cereal crops harvested for hay or harvested green for food, feed, or silage and those used for grazing are excluded.
